Celery: Distributed Task Queue
Development
Celery is an open source Python library for handling asynchronous tasks and job queues. It allows defining tasks that can be executed asynchronously, monitoring them, and getting notified when they are finished. Celery supports scheduling tasks and integrating with a variety of services.

Virtkick
Network & Admin
Virtkick is a virtual machine management platform designed for managing VMs in the cloud or on-premises. It provides a simple yet powerful interface for provisioning, monitoring, and managing VMs across multiple hypervisors.
